Subject: [PATCH] KVM: nVMX: Do not emulate #UD while in guest mode

While in L2, leave all #UD to L2 and do not try to emulate it. If L1 is
interested in doing this, it reports its interest via the exception
bitmap, and we never get into handle_exception of L0 anyway.

Noticed while wondering where the vmmcall of a misconfigured L2 went on
an Intel box: to nowhere. This bug caused a spurious fixup, and the
emulator bug did not even let it trigger a vmcall vmexit.
arch/x86/kvm/vmx.c | 4 ++++
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)
diff --git a/arch/x86/kvm/vmx.c b/arch/x86/kvm/vmx.c
index f7b20b4..fa0627c 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kvm/vmx.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kvm/vmx.c
@@ -5065,6 +5065,10 @@ static int handle_exception(stru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u)
}
if (is_invalid_opcode(intr_info)) {
+ if (is_guest_mode(vcpu)) {
+ kvm_queue_exception(vcpu, UD_VECTOR);
+ return 1;
+ }
er = emulate_instruction(vcpu, EMULTYPE_TRAP_UD);
if (er != EMULATE_DONE)
kvm_queue_exception(vcpu, UD_VECTOR);
